Food retail sales in Hungary decreased by both in value and quantities
According to Nielsen market research company; the value of food retail turnover reduced in 10 developed European countries, including Hungary, in the last quarter of 2009, compared to the same period of 2008.
Among the tested 21 European countries, retail sales decreased in the following countries in last year's fourth quarter, compared to the previous October-December period: Ireland and Slovakia (6-6 percent), Czech Republic (4), Finland (3 ), Portugal (2), Denmark, Greece, Hungary, Germany and Italy (1-1).
Nielsen registered decrease in quantities in six countries together with Hungary.
The rate of inflation remained 1.3 percent in the fourth quarter in the European countries, while last year's totalinflation was 1.5 percent.
